Dorian Hunter – Season 10 Winner

Dorian Hunter, who was crowned the winner of MasterChef Season 10, has been busy since her victory. She was awarded the $250,000 grand prize and an opportunity to train in the kitchens of the judges’ restaurants. Dorian has been working on her cookbook and has made several appearances at culinary events across the country.

Sarah Faherty – Runner-Up

Sarah Faherty, an Army veteran and the runner-up of the season, impressed the judges with her culinary skills and determination. After the show, Sarah continued to pursue her passion for cooking. She has been involved in pop-up dinners and has been an advocate for veteran-related causes, using her platform to raise awareness and support.

Nick DiGiovanni – Third Place

Nick DiGiovanni, the youngest contestant to ever make it to the top three on MasterChef, has not slowed down since his time on the show. He has become a social media sensation, sharing his culinary creations with a vast online audience. Nick has also been working on his own food-related projects and collaborations.
